Roast Beef and Pepper Open-Faced Sandwiches

Ingredients

  • 2 Tbsp. vegetable oil
  • 3/4 cup sliced green bell pepper
  • 3/4 cup sliced red bell pepper
  • 1/2 cup sliced onion
  • 2 cups sliced mushrooms
  • 1 Tbsp.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 Tbsp. chopped fresh cilantro
  • 3/4 lb. sliced roast beef
  • 8 large slices French or Italian bread
  • 1/2 cup mayonnaise (optional)
  • 2 cups (8 oz.) Sargento® ChefStyle Shredded Mozzarella Cheese

Directions

  1. Heat oil in large skillet over medium heat. Add bell peppers, onion and mushrooms; cook, stirring frequently, 7 minutes or until crisp-tender. Stir in Worcestershire sauce, cilantro and roast beef. Cook just until beef is warmed through; set aside.
  2. Spread bread slices with mayonnaise if desired; place on baking sheet. Cover with meat and pepper mixture; top with cheese. Bake in preheated 350°F oven 5 minutes or until cheese is melted.
